The diaphragm pressure gauge operates by using a flexible diaphragm that deflects under pressure. This deflection is transmitted to a pointer on a dial, providing a visual representation of the pressure level.

Yes, the diaphragm pressure gauge is available in materials that are resistant to corrosion, such as stainless steel, making it suitable for various corrosive applications.
While the diaphragm pressure gauge is designed for low maintenance, periodic checks for accuracy and functionality are recommended, especially in critical applications.
Regular calibration and maintenance checks can help ensure the accuracy of your diaphragm pressure gauge. It is advisable to follow the manufacturer's guidelines for calibration intervals.
